Introduction

A medium-sized software development company specializing in developing custom web and mobile applications for clients across various industries. With a growing client base and increasing project demands, the IT Technology faced challenges in efficiently managing their application deployment processes and ensuring scalability and reliability of their infrastructure.

Complex Deployment Processes: The IT Technology company encountered difficulties in deploying applications consistently across different environments due to the complexity of managing dependencies and configurations manually.


Scalability Constraints: With traditional infrastructure setups, the IT Technology company struggled to scale their applications efficiently to handle sudden spikes in traffic or increasing workload demands.


Resource Underutilization: The company was concerned about resource underutilization and wanted to optimize their infrastructure costs by dynamically scaling resources based on demand.

To address these challenges, the IT Technology company decided to adopt a Container-as-a-Service (CaaS) approach. After evaluating various options, they opted for vSphere Integrated Containers due to its robust features and seamless integration.

Streamlined Deployment Processes: With vSphere Integrated Containers, the IT Technology company achieved consistent and reliable application deployments across different environments, reducing the complexity associated with managing dependencies and configurations manually.


Improved Scalability: vSphere Integrated Containers auto-scaling feature allowed the IT Technology company to scale their applications dynamically in response to changes in traffic or workload demands, ensuring optimal resource utilization and better performance during peak times.


Cost Optimization: By leveraging containerization and dynamic scaling capabilities, the IT Technology company optimized their infrastructure costs by only provisioning and paying for the resources they actually used, thereby reducing resource underutilization.

Conclusion

In conclusion, the adoption of Container-as-a-Service (CaaS) with vSphere Integrated Containers enabled IT Technology company to overcome their deployment challenges, improve scalability and reliability, optimize infrastructure costs, and enhance overall operational efficiency. By leveraging containerization, automation, and orchestration, the IT Technology company transformed their application development and deployment workflows, allowing them to deliver high-quality software faster and more efficiently to meet their clients' evolving needs.
